diff --git a/include/codi/tapes/indices/reuseIndexManagerBase.hpp b/include/codi/tapes/indices/reuseIndexManagerBase.hpp index 0c299fb7..814e174c 100644 --- a/include/codi/tapes/indices/reuseIndexManagerBase.hpp +++ b/include/codi/tapes/indices/reuseIndexManagerBase.hpp @@ -197,6 +197,7 @@ namespace codi { template CODI_INLINE void freeIndex(Index& index) { if (valid && Base::InactiveIndex != index) { // Do not free the zero index. + codiAssert(index <= cast().getLargestCreatedIndex()); EventSystem::notifyIndexFreeListeners(index);